我对bootstrap很新,我似乎无法找到问题的答案。我正在使用视频标签嵌入我的网站中播放本地视频。当我退出模式时,我需要使用一些javascript来停止播放视频。只是无法使我的任何解决方案工作 - 我尝试采用iFrame解决方案。
<div class="modal fade" id="videoModal">
<div class="modal-dialog modal-lg">
<div class="modal-content">
<div class="modal-header1">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
<h4 class="modal-title">What can Minecraft do for your class!</h4>
</div>
<div class="modal-body">
<div class="embed-responsive embed-responsive-16by9">
<video id="my_video_1" class="video-js vjs-default-skin embed-responsive-item" controls preload="auto" data-setup="{}">
<source src="videos/Minecraft greenscree.mp4" type='video/mp4'>
</video>
</div>
</div>
</div>
</div>
</div>
答案 0 :(得分:0)
您可以加入模态的隐藏事件,然后停止视频。
像这样:
$('#viewModal').on('hide.bs-modal', function(e) {
$('#my_view_1').trigger('pause');
});